About This Lesson

Eth-Noh-Tec presents "The Long Haired Girl," a legend from China. A synthesis of music, movement and words, this performance fuses Eastern and Western artistic motifs. The performers share narration and transition between different characters within the story. Embellished with rhythmic dialogue, poses and comic facial gestures, it combines traditional Asian theatre with modern ideas. Lessons emphasize the elements of a story, as well as techniques for animated telling with physical interpretations. Universal themes: Transformation, Enduring Values and The Human Family.
